资源简介:
Experiments were carried out in soil microcosms with treatment with three pesticides in preparative forms - imidacloprid, benomyl and metribuzin in single and tenfold application rates. For additional stimulation of microorganisms, a starch-mineral mixture was added to some variants. For all samples, high-throughput sequencing on the Illumina MiSeq platform of the V4 and ITS1 fragments of the 16S and 18S rRNA gene was carried out. As a result, it was possible to establish the characteristic changes in the structure of the fungal and bacterial communities, which are characteristic of pesticide treatment. The change in the relative representation of the genera Terrabacter, Kitasatospora, Streptomyces, Sphingomonas, Apiotrichum, Solicoccozyma, Gamsia, Humicola can be proposed as a marker of pesticide contamination. It is proposed to use these signs for mass assessment of the effect of pesticides on soil microbiota instead of classical integral methods, including within the framework of state registration of pesticides. It is also proposed to conduct research on the effect of pesticides on the soil microbiome during artificially initiated successions using the introduction of substrates.
